| Alterations to its controversial styling and more standard features mark the 2002 Aztek. This minivan/SUV crossover is based on Pontiacs Montana minivan. It has four conventional side doors and a glass rear liftgate in combination with a drop-down tailgate. Aztek offers front-wheel drive or General Motors Versatrak all-wheel drive. The AWD system lacks low-range gearing and is not intended for off-road use. Front side airbags and ABS are standard; AWD versions add 4-wheel disc brakes. Azteks unconventional styling contributed to slow sales in its 2001 debut year. The big appearance change for 02 is a revised paint scheme that substitutes body-color trim for gray lower-body cladding. Wheel designs also change and include 3-spoke alloys for the 2WD model. An insulated front-console cooler and CD player are now standard instead of optional. Traction control is optional with 2WD. Other options include heated leather front seats, a slide-out cargo-floor section with storage bins and rollaway wheels, and GMs OnStar |
